Patronising & seemingly inexperienced staff

January 31, 2020
Awful experiences of care here. All of the members of staff I have dealt with have hugely downplayed the issues I have explained and made me feel patronised. It seems that the majority of them don’t even have a basic understanding of how to build rapport with a patient or talk to them on a human level, let alone have a good understanding of how to deal with someone in crisis. After telling them I felt suicidal with intent and plans I was sent home with a number to ring if ‘anything changes’. I can now understand why people feel that they have to make an attempt on their life to get the help they need, so very sad but true! This team seriously needs assessing as from my experiences I have walked out of there feeling genuinely worse in my mental health that when I walked in. Terrible.
I appreciate the NHS and mental health services are stretched beyond capacity but that doesn’t excuse staff members nonchalant attitude and lack of basic people skills. It’s inexcusable.

Caroline Reilly

Ok appointment

December 16, 2019
My consultant has been off sick for 9 months. My appointment seemed to have been forgotten whilst she is off sick, I only got to see a Dr after I asked why I hadn't seen anyone for nearly a year. It's been too hard to get my medication, as the GP won't give it, so I've just stopped taking it whilst I wasn't seeing anyone.
Locum Dr appointment was fine though, was polite and covered things that needed, but was very quick, so felt a bit rushed and that it was hard to open up.

Really hate having to go through a security check before appointments, they go though everything in your bag, and scan all over your body. It makes a stressful experience so much worse, as it's so invasive and degrading. They even searched through a pocket in my bag with tampons and sanitary towels in, which should be private. I didn't want to use them after a strange man had touched them all over. I feel like a criminal, when I'm just there because I need help. It's not my fault.
